Michelle's Brasserie     Birmingham
Description:
Gourmet Food available in the heart of the UK! Michelles has been delighting the gourmets of Birmingham for over a quarter of a century.The first restaurant opened by Michelle Vale, who originates from the Burgundy region of France set new standards for style, taste and sheer pleasure.Now her son, Nigel, is continuing the tradition and invites you to experience Michelles hospitality at two superb venues, each with its own distinct character.
